Bodhi Day 2025: 25 Buddha Quotes To Enlighten Your Mind, Heart, And Daily Life
Today, 8th December, 2025 is Bodhi Day. This marks the day Siddhartha Gautama attained enlightenment under the Bodhi tree in Bodh Gaya. It is a day to take a moment to reflect, and connect with values like mindfulness, clarity, and compassion. Observed by Buddhists and spiritual seekers alike, the day encourages meditation, self-reflection, and a focus on the present moment.
Why Bodhi Day Is Celebrated
The day is celebrated to honour the Buddha's journey toward awakening and the insights he gained along the way. The day is about slowing down, observing the mind, and cultivating understanding and kindness. Many people often meditate, read the teachings, practise loving-kindness, or simply take a moment to reflect on their own path.
25 Teachings From The Buddha
1.
"All
conditioned
things
are
impermanent."
2.
"By
oneself
is
evil
done;
by
oneself
is
one
purified."
3.
"Hatred
is
never
appeased
by
hatred.
It
is
appeased
by
love."
4.
"The
world
is
led
by
the
mind."
5.
"As
rain
enters
a
broken
house,
so
desire
enters
an
untrained
mind."
6.
"Better
than
a
thousand
hollow
words
is
one
word
that
brings
peace."
7.
"Just
as
a
solid
rock
is
unshaken
by
the
wind,
the
wise
are
unshaken
by
praise
or
blame."
8.
"Paying
attention
to
the
present
moment
is
the
path
to
insight."
9.
"One
who
sees
dependent
origination
sees
the
Dhamma."
10.
"Health
is
the
greatest
gift,
contentment
the
greatest
wealth."
11.
"Enduring
patience
is
the
highest
austerity."
12.
"Whatever
is
felt
is
included
in
suffering."
13.
"There
is
no
fire
like
passion,
no
grip
like
hatred,
no
net
like
delusion."
14.
"Meditation
leads
to
freedom
from
desire."
15.
"What
you
frequently
think
about
becomes
the
inclination
of
the
mind."
16.
"Let
none
deceive
another
or
despise
anyone
anywhere."
17.
"The
wise
do
not
tremble
in
the
face
of
adversity."
18.
"Not
by
birth
is
one
noble,
but
by
deeds."
19.
"The
one
who
has
conquered
the
self
is
greater
than
the
conqueror
of
a
thousand
men
in
battle."
20.
"Happiness
arises
from
a
clear
and
steady
mind."
21.
"In
this
fathom-long
body
is
the
world,
the
origin
of
the
world,
the
cessation
of
the
world."
22.
"Monks,
I
teach
suffering
and
the
end
of
suffering."
23.
"When
one
sees
the
arising
and
passing
of
the
five
aggregates,
one
is
filled
with
joy
and
gladness."
24.
"You
yourselves
must
strive;
the
Buddhas
only
show
the
way."
25.
"All
things
vanish.
Strive
with
earnestness."
Bodhi Day 2025 reminds us that understanding, compassion, and awareness are cultivated through steady effort, reflection, and mindfulness. These teachings provide practical guidance for daily life, small changes in thought and action that bring clarity and peace. Even a few minutes of reflection today can be a meaningful step toward inner balance.
